Cracks

uPVC is designed to last and energy efficient as well as long-lasting. However, they can be damaged. It is essential to repair a window crack as quickly as you can. If you don't fix the crack, it can grow and cause more damage to your home. A uPVC specialist can fix the window that has been damaged and stop it from further damage.

There are many reasons why your uPVC window might break. The most frequent reason is due to temperature changes. The sudden increase or decrease in temperature can cause the glass to expand or shrink, leading to cracks. This is especially true if the window is placed in an exposed location.

A uPVC frame crack could also be caused by damage. This could be caused by hitting the window with a heavy object, or even leaning a ladder against it. The resulting pressure can cause the frame to crack, or even break.

Fortunately, uPVC window cracks can be repaired relatively easily. The first step is to clean the crack using detergent and water. After that, fill the crack with the acrylic compound. Apply the compound within two minutes of mixing it, and make sure that it is absorbed into the crack. You should then sand the patch to smooth it out.

Scratches

UPVC, although it is a tough and versatile material, is susceptible to damage from mechanical forces like pitting or scratches. There are several ways to repair this type of damage. First, you must examine the scratched area and determine its severity. If it is deep enough that you can feel it with your fingernail then it is likely to be buffed using finer and more intense sandpaper to eliminate it completely. If the scratch is small and not deep enough, a quick buff will solve the issue.

It is recommended to clean the glass thoroughly with a glass cleaner before you attempt any of these DIY methods. Dry it completely. This will remove any dirt or debris that could exacerbate the scratches and make them appear more obvious. Then you can use a soft, non-linty cloth to wipe the damaged glass. Microfibre cloths are ideal for this job because they can withstand moisture and resist scratching, and are easy to clean. Paper towels and other abrasive cleaners should be avoided since they may etch or scratch the glass's surface.

If you're suffering from uPVC window scratches You can try to remove them using household items. White toothpaste, particularly if it contains baking soda, can be extremely effective for this purpose. Apply a small amount to a soft clean, dry cloth that is free of lint and gently rub the scratched surface in circular motions. After about 30 seconds, check the result and repeat the process until the scratches are invisible.

You can also apply a polish that is specifically made for plastic surfaces, such as T-Cut or brass cleaner, to remove scratches from your uPVC windows. Ensure that you use the polish in accordance with the directions, and be cautious to avoid excessive application, as too much polish can dull or scratch the surface of your window.
